Tassos Lycurgo earned an education doctorate in mathematics and logic from the Federal University of Rio Grande do Norte (UFRN) and an MA in analytic philosophy from the University of Sussex. He is a professor at UFRN and founder of Defesa da Fé Ministries, where he serves as pastor. An attorney and author of several books on philosophy, law, and apologetics, he speaks globally to present the historical, scientific, and philosophical case for faith. He also completed postdoctoral studies in Christian apologetics at Oral Roberts University.

Fuz Rana is a biochemist, author, and Christian apologist specializing in human origins, genetics, and the scientific evidence for design. President, CEO, and senior scholar at Reasons to Believe (RTB), he formerly served as a senior scientist in research and development at Procter & Gamble. Rana earned a BS in chemistry with highest honors from West Virginia State College (now University) and a PhD in chemistry with an emphasis in biochemistry from Ohio University. He pursued postdoctoral studies on cell membranes at the Universities of Virginia and Georgia. Read More
